National Conventions

National Conventions is a publication in two volumes prepared by the Convention Coordinating Committee of the Canadian Square & Round Dance Society to help dancers bidding for and organizing Canadian National Square and Round Dance Conventions. It incorporates the experience of those who have organized previous conventions.  These 2 volumes are available in pdf format (see below).

 Volume One (106KB) outlines the procedures to be followed on bidding for a convention and is issued to all federations proposing to hold a national convention.
 Volume Two (187KB) contains suggestions for the operation of a convention. Part of the task of the Convention Coordinating Committee is to review the minutes of previous convention boards in order to continually update these suggestions.
